Nepoleon Prabakaran previously worked as an Assistant Professor at CMS Business School, JAIN (Deemed-to-be University), and a doctoral researcher pursuing his PhD in the areas of consumer neuroscience and the implications of the metaverse. Before entering academia, he worked with ICICI Bank, gaining industry insights that continue to shape his teaching and research. He holds an MBA in Marketing and Analytics and a background in Information Technology, enabling him to integrate quantitative, technological, and managerial perspectives in his academic work. His research interests span consumer behavior, organizational behavior, and emerging technologies, with a strong emphasis on responsible AI and its role in education and management. Mr. Prabakaran has an active research portfolio with over 25 publications, including more than 10 papers indexed in Scopus and 14 papers indexed in Web of Science. His publications explore themes such as transformational leadership, consumer behavior in digital contexts, job crafting and employee flourishing, cultural intelligence, and the role of the metaverse in shaping organizational and consumer practices.Selected Publications include:
In addition to research, he is recognized for his teaching in operations management and decision sciences, where he blends contemporary tools with traditional pedagogy to enhance student learning and bridge the gap between theory, research, and practice.
